Palit GeForce GTX 1080 Ti GameRock Premium
vs
GIGABYTE AORUS GeForce RTX 2080 8G


GPU comparison with benchmarks

The Palit GeForce GTX 1080 Ti GameRock Premium is based on the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1080 Ti (Pascal) and has 11 GB GDDR5X graphics memory with a bandwidth of 484 GB/s.

The GIGABYTE AORUS GeForce RTX 2080 8G is based on the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2080 (Turing) and has 8 GB GDDR6 graphics memory with a bandwidth of 448 GB/s.

GPU

The Palit GeForce GTX 1080 Ti GameRock Premium has the GP102-350-K1-A1 graphics chip installed, which is based on the Pascal architecture.

The GIGABYTE AORUS GeForce RTX 2080 8G is based on the graphics chip TU104, which comes from the Turing architecture.

Memory

The graphics memory of the Palit GeForce GTX 1080 Ti GameRock Premium clocks at 1.376 GHz, which corresponds to a speed of 11.0 Gbps.

The graphics memory speed of the GIGABYTE AORUS GeForce RTX 2080 8G is 14.0 Gbps and the clock speed is 1.750 GHz.

Thermal Design

The Palit GeForce GTX 1080 Ti GameRock Premium is powered by 2 x 8-Pin connectors. The TDP (Thermal Design Power) of the graphics card is 300 W.

The GIGABYTE AORUS GeForce RTX 2080 8G has 2 x 8-Pin PCIe power connectors that supply it with energy. The manufacturer specifies the TDP of the card as 215 W.

Additional data

The Palit GeForce GTX 1080 Ti GameRock Premium has been manufactured with a structure width of 16 nanometers since Q1/2017.

The GIGABYTE AORUS GeForce RTX 2080 8G came on the market in Q4/2018 and will have a structure width of 12 nanometers manufactured.
